‟A language-theoretic characterization of f.g. subgroups of Thompson V” by Davide Perego <dperego9@gmail.com>, Université de Genève
Abstract:
The intersection of formal language theory and group theory provides a fascinating lens for studying algebraic structures, most notably through the word problem. This connection has allowed mathematicians to classify groups based on the Chomsky hierarchy. While the landmark Muller-Schupp theorem completely characterized groups with context-free word problems, progressing beyond this boundary has remained a major challenge. In this talk, we shift toward a more combinatorial and geometric approach. We will introduce a new framework that yields a characterization of the f.g. subgroups of Thompson V. Notably, this group is central to a well-known 2008 conjecture regarding groups with co-context-free word problems. Joint works with Corentin Bodart, Daniele D’Angeli, Francesco Matucci and Emanuele Rodaro.
